۞ And your Lord has decreed that you worship none but Him. And that you be dutiful to your parents. If one of them or both of them attain old age in your life, say not to them a word of disrespect, nor shout at them but address them in terms of honour. 23 And, out of kindness, lower to them the wing of humility, and say: "My Lord! bestow on them thy Mercy even as they cherished me in childhood." 24 Your Lord knows very well what is in your hearts if you are righteous, for He is All-forgiving to those who are penitent. 25 Give to the near of kin, the needy and the destitute traveler their rights and do not squander, 26 Lo! the squanderers were ever brothers of the devils, and the devil was ever an ingrate to his Lord. 27 And even if thou hast to turn away from them in pursuit of the Mercy from thy Lord which thou dost expect, yet speak to them a word of easy kindness. 28 Be neither miserly, nor so open-handed that you suffer reproach and become destitute. 29 Truly, your Lord enlarges the provision for whom He wills and straitens (for whom He wills). Verily, He is Ever All-Knower, All-Seer of His slaves. 30
